facebooktwitterpinterest
All Spa Repairs & The Hot Tub Shop
33465 Maclure Rd #102, V2S 0C4, Abbotsford, BC
(604) 807-1586
  • (21)
4 comment
preview photo
All Spa Repairs & The Hot Tub Shop
33465 Maclure Rd unit 102,, V2S 0C4, Abbotsford, BC
(604) 807-1586
  • (21)
4 comment
preview photo
Abbotsford Hot Tub & Pool Map, Satellite View of List